Monday Night Raw 05/12 witnessed quite a few surprises and Oba Femi‘s appearance was one of them. The NXT North American champion was standing ringside when Alpha Academy arrived in the arena for a match against the new stable, ‘American Made’. The commentators expressed their confusion upon seeing the superstar from the developmental brand on Raw.

Oba Femi is carrying the title for 214 days and counting. His journey began on the 9th of January this year and it seems like it will go on for longer than we expect. Seeing Femi on Raw could also have been a hint that he may be joining the main roster soon. But what was the real reason that we saw him tonight?

WWE hosts its Speed matches and Main Event matches for Peacock usually after its weekly shows to keep the fans entertained for longer. However, it was a bit different on 08/12. WWE surprised the fans with early Main Event and Speed matches for some reason. Oba Femi was part of the first Main Event. The intimidating champion was up against Dante Chen. He ended up owning the latter in the squared circle and fans seemed to enjoy the match. Following his match, Femi decided to stick around, resulting in an exchange between him and Otis later in the night. Femi was able to successfully defend his title against Chen. But since he has also accepted the ‘open challenge’, his fortunes could also turn around on the black and yellow brand of WWE soon.

Before the match even began, Ivy Nile arrived backstage to have a conversation with Maxxine Dupri. She suggested that she stay out of the feud and leave the Creed Brothers alone. Not only that, but she also suggested that they all join the ‘American Made’ faction because Chad Gable wishes so. Dupri, thinking that Nile would understand, politely declined the invite. Instead, she supported her ‘family’ to go and face the goons that have been troubling them on the main roster for a long time now. Towards the end of the match, Nile attacked Dupri, who was standing near the apron, and went on to slam her on the announce table.
